What is a Calendar Spread?
A calendar spread, also known as a time spread, involves simultaneously buying and selling futures contracts of the *same* underlying asset (in this case, BTC) with different expiration dates.
- Long Leg: Buying a futures contract with a later expiration date. This benefits from time decay as the contract approaches expiration.
- Short Leg: Selling a futures contract with an earlier expiration date. This is negatively affected by time decay, but the initial premium received can offset this.
The goal is to profit from the difference in the rate of time decay between the two contracts. Ideally, the long leg will experience less time decay than the short leg, leading to a profit as the expiration date of the short leg approaches.

The Role of Stablecoins (USDT & USDC)
Stablecoins like USDT and USDC play a vital role in facilitating calendar spread trading, particularly in managing risk and optimizing capital efficiency.
- Collateral: Futures exchanges typically require margin to open and maintain positions. Stablecoins are frequently accepted as collateral for these margin requirements. Using stablecoins allows traders to participate in futures trading without directly converting their holdings to BTC, reducing exposure to BTC’s price volatility.
- Settlement: Profits from calendar spreads are often settled in stablecoins, providing a safe and stable store of value.
- Pair Trading & Arbitrage: Stablecoins are central to pair trading strategies (explained below) and arbitrage opportunities between different exchanges.
- Risk Management: Holding a portion of your trading capital in stablecoins provides a buffer against unforeseen market events. If a trade goes against you, you have stablecoins readily available to cover potential losses.

Pair Trading with Stablecoins: A Complementary Strategy
Pair trading involves identifying two correlated assets and taking opposing positions in them, expecting their price relationship to revert to the mean. Stablecoins are crucial for executing these trades. Here are a couple of examples:
- BTC/USDT vs. BTC/USDC: If the price of BTC when purchased with USDT is significantly different from the price of BTC when purchased with USDC on the same exchange, a trader can:
* Buy BTC with USDC (where it's cheaper). * Sell BTC for USDT (where it's more expensive). * This exploits a temporary price discrepancy and profits from the convergence of prices.
- BTC/USDT on Different Exchanges: Price discrepancies can also exist between different cryptocurrency exchanges. A trader could:
* Buy BTC with USDT on Exchange A (lower price). * Sell BTC for USDT on Exchange B (higher price). * This is a form of arbitrage, and stablecoins facilitate the quick transfer of value between exchanges.
Risk Management & Considerations
While calendar spreads offer reduced risk compared to outright positions, they are not risk-free.
- Roll Risk: As the short-leg contract nears expiration, you need to "roll" the spread by closing the expiring contract and opening a new one with a later expiration date. This roll can incur costs if the price difference between the contracts is unfavorable.
- Correlation Risk: Pair trading relies on the correlation between assets. If the correlation breaks down, the trade can result in losses.
- Liquidity Risk: Ensure sufficient liquidity in both futures contracts to enter and exit positions efficiently.
- Exchange Risk: Choose reputable cryptocurrency futures exchanges with robust security measures. See Cryptocurrency futures exchanges for a list of options.
- Margin Requirements: Understand the margin requirements of the exchange and ensure you have sufficient collateral (stablecoins) to cover potential losses.
